Your Journey into Irritable Bowel Syndrome

Irritable Bowel Syndrome (IBS) is a disorder characterized most commonly by cramping, abdominal pain, bloating, constipation, and diarrhea.

As its name indicates, Irritable Bowel Syndrome is a syndrome. That is, IBS is a combination of signs and symptoms, but not a disease. IBS is classified as a functional disorder. A functional disorder refers to a condition where the primary abnormality is an altered physiological function (the way the body works), rather than an identifiable inflammatory, infectious, structural, or biochemical cause.

Research also indicates that IBS is a multi-faceted disorder. For example, the symptoms of IBS result from what seems to be a disturbance or imbalance in the interaction between the intestines, the brain, sensory function, and the autonomic nervous system that alters regulation of bowel motility (motor function).

    Risk Factors for IBS

    The main risk factors for Irritable Bowel Syndrome (IBS) include:

    • Sex
    • Family History

    For example, you are far more likely to have IBS if you're young and female. In fact, two to three times as many women as men have the condition.

    In addition, IBS does seem to run in families, possibly suggesting a genetic cause for the condition.

    However, at the current time, the precise cause of Irritable Bowel Syndrome (IBS) is not known.

    Study Finds Structural Brain Alterations In Patients With Irritable Bowel Syndrome
    A large academic study has demonstrated structural changes in specific brain regions in female patients with irritable bowel syndrome (IBS), a condition that causes pain and discomfort in the abdomen, along with diarrhea, constipation or both. A collaborative effort between UCLA and Canada's McGill University, the study appears in the July issue of the journal Gastroenterology...
